欧美第8页 I 日本人体麻豆片区 I 五月综合激情婷婷 I www.日本精品 I 国产人伦视频 I 国产视频尤物自拍在线免费观看 I 夜夜夜操操操 I 欧美特一级片 I 综合色综合 I 丝袜熟女国偷自产中文字幕亚洲 I 国产10000部拍拍拍免费视频 I 青青草99 I 自拍三级视频 I 91香蕉在线视频 I 欧美一区二区在线视频观看 I 国产69精品久久久久99尤 I 青青青国产在线观看免费 I 美女操操私人影院 I 亚洲三级一区 I 在线你懂得 I 亚洲日韩欧美一区二区在线 I 亚洲人成网77777香蕉 I 黄色网久久 I 亚洲无套 I 久久一级黄色大片 I 97久久综合区小说区图片区 I 韩国视频一区二区三区 I 800av在线免费观看视频

如何在免費云服務器上設置SSL證書?

如何在免費云服務器上設置SSL證書?

在現代網站的安全性中,SSL證書(安全套接字層證書)扮演著至關重要的角色。它不僅能加密瀏覽器和服務器之間的數據通信,確保用戶的隱私和數據安全,而且還能增強網站的信任度,提高搜索引擎排名。本文將介紹如何在美國的免費云服務器(如VPS或云主機)上設置SSL證書,包括使用Let's Encrypt提供的免費證書以及通過一些常見的配置方法來完成這一過程。

如何在免費云服務器上設置SSL證書?-美聯科技

1. 什么是SSL證書?為什么需要它?

1.1 SSL證書概述

SSL證書是一種數字證書,用于通過加密協議保護網絡通信,確保數據在用戶瀏覽器與網站之間傳輸時不會被竊取或篡改。它通過在URL前添加 "HTTPS" 前綴來表示該網站使用了安全協議,相比HTTP,HTTPS可以大大降低數據被截取的風險。

1.2 SSL證書的重要性

  • 加密通信:通過加密協議保障瀏覽器與服務器之間的數據傳輸安全。
  • 提高信任度:網站展示HTTPS標志,增加訪客對網站的信任。
  • SEO優勢:搜索引擎(如Google)傾向于優先展示使用SSL證書的站點。
  • 保護隱私:防止用戶的個人信息如密碼、支付信息被泄露。

2. 選擇適合的免費云服務器

在設置SSL證書之前,首先需要在云平臺上部署服務器。美國的免費云服務器平臺,如Amazon Web Services (AWS)、Google Cloud Platform (GCP)、Oracle Cloud、Vultr、DigitalOcean等,都提供了一定額度的免費試用資源。

2.1 創建并部署云服務器

以AWS為例,以下是創建云服務器的基本步驟:

  1. 注冊并登錄AWS賬號。
  2. 在AWS管理控制臺選擇EC2服務。
  3. 創建一個新的EC2實例,選擇適合的操作系統(推薦使用Linux系統,如Ubuntu)。
  4. 配置實例的安全組,允許HTTP(80端口)和HTTPS(443端口)流量。
  5. 啟動實例,獲取分配的公網IP地址。

3. 如何使用Let's Encrypt免費SSL證書

3.1 什么是Let's Encrypt?

Let's Encrypt是一個免費的、自動化的證書頒發機構(CA),為網站提供免費的SSL/TLS證書。它由非盈利組織Internet Security Research Group(ISRG)管理,旨在提高互聯網的安全性。Let's Encrypt的證書是受廣泛支持的,適用于大部分現代瀏覽器。

3.2 安裝Certbot(Let's Encrypt的客戶端工具)

在云服務器上獲取Let's Encrypt證書的步驟之一是安裝Certbot,Certbot是一個自動化工具,幫助你與Let's Encrypt交互,并簡化證書的申請和續期過程。

在Ubuntu服務器上安裝Certbot

  1. 更新系統包:
    sudo apt update
    
  2. 安裝Certbot和Nginx插件(如果你使用的是Nginx):
    sudo apt install certbot python3-certbot-nginx
    
  3. 如果使用的是Apache,安裝相應的插件:
    sudo apt install certbot python3-certbot-apache
    

3.3 使用Certbot申請SSL證書

  1. 運行以下命令以為你的網站自動申請SSL證書:

    如果你使用Nginx:

    sudo certbot --nginx
    

    如果你使用Apache:

    sudo certbot --apache
    
  2. Certbot將會自動配置Nginx或Apache以支持SSL,并生成所需的證書文件。你只需要提供你的電子郵件地址以接收證書的更新提醒。
  3. 輸入域名,Certbot會驗證你的域名所有權(通常是通過DNS驗證或HTTP驗證),并生成證書。

3.4 自動續期

Let's Encrypt的證書有效期為90天,但你可以設置自動續期。Certbot默認會自動為你配置續期任務。你可以通過運行以下命令來測試自動續期是否正常工作:

sudo certbot renew --dry-run

4. 配置Nginx或Apache以支持SSL

4.1 配置Nginx

假設Certbot已經成功為你的域名安裝并配置了SSL證書,接下來你需要檢查并確保Nginx正確配置了HTTPS支持。

  1. 打開Nginx配置文件(通常位于/etc/nginx/sites-available/目錄下)。
    sudo nano /etc/nginx/sites-available/default
    
  2. 確保以下內容存在,并且是正確的:
    server {
        listen 80;
        server_name your_domain.com;
        return 301 https://$host$request_uri;
    }
    
    server {
        listen 443 ssl;
        server_name your_domain.com;
    
        ssl_certificate /etc/letsencrypt/live/your_domain.com/fullchain.pem;
        ssl_certificate_key /etc/letsencrypt/live/your_domain.com/privkey.pem;
    
        # SSL安全設置
        ssl_protocols TLSv1.2 TLSv1.3;
        ssl_ciphers 'HIGH:!aNULL:!MD5';
        ssl_prefer_server_ciphers on;
    
        location / {
            # 站點根目錄設置
            root /var/www/html;
            index index.html index.htm;
        }
    }
    
  3. 保存并關閉文件,檢查Nginx配置是否正確:
    sudo nginx -t
    
  4. 重新加載Nginx配置:
    sudo systemctl reload nginx
    

4.2 配置Apache

如果你使用Apache,Certbot會自動為你配置SSL。在某些情況下,你可能需要手動檢查Apache的SSL配置。

  1. 打開Apache SSL配置文件:
    sudo nano /etc/apache2/sites-available/default-ssl.conf
    
  2. 確保以下配置存在:
    <VirtualHost _default_:443>
        ServerAdmin webmaster@localhost
        ServerName your_domain.com
    
        SSLEngine on
        SSLCertificateFile /etc/letsencrypt/live/your_domain.com/fullchain.pem
        SSLCertificateKeyFile /etc/letsencrypt/live/your_domain.com/privkey.pem
    
        # SSL安全設置
        SSLProtocol all -SSLv2 -SSLv3
        SSLCipherSuite HIGH:!aNULL:!MD5
        SSLHonorCipherOrder on
    
        DocumentRoot /var/www/html
    </VirtualHost>
    
  3. 啟用SSL模塊并重新啟動Apache:
    sudo a2enmod ssl
    sudo systemctl restart apache2
    

5. 測試SSL配置

最后,訪問你的域名(如https://your_domain.com),確保網站能夠通過HTTPS加載,并且瀏覽器顯示綠色的鎖形圖標。

你還可以使用工具如SSL Labs SSL Test來檢查你的網站SSL配置的安全性和可靠性。

如何在免費云服務器上設置SSL證書?-美聯科技

總結

在美國的免費云服務器上設置SSL證書,不僅能確保網站的安全性,還能提升用戶體驗和SEO排名。通過使用Let's Encrypt提供的免費證書,以及使用Certbot自動化工具,您可以輕松為您的網站啟用SSL證書,并確保您的數據傳輸安全。只需幾個步驟,您就能在自己的云服務器上完成這一過程,進一步保障您的在線業務。

客戶經理
主站蜘蛛池模板: 国产国产成年年人免费看片 | 后入内射欧美99二区视频 | 日日摸夜夜摸狠狠摸婷婷 | 色与欲影视天天看综合网 | 亚洲欧洲日韩 | 丰满的少妇xxxxx青青青 | 男人添女人下部高潮视频 | 91视频区| 极品白丝美女在线出水 | 亚洲欧美v国产蜜芽tv | 亚洲国产精品综合久久20 | 成人3d动漫一区二区三区 | 欧美性猛交xxx嘿人猛交 | 亚洲中文字幕精品久久久久久动漫 | 久99久无码精品视频免费播放 | 国产女厕偷窥系列在线视频 | 日韩精品久久久肉伦网站 | 欧美大荫蒂毛茸茸视频 | 精品国产乱码久久久久久郑州公司 | 国产粗话肉麻对白在线播放 | 国产又爽又猛又粗的视频a片 | 中文字幕av一区 | 中文字幕人乱码中文 | 国产精品综合av一区二区国产馆 | 无码国产精品一区二区免费式直播 | 国产成人久久久精品二区三区 | 一本色道无码道dvd在线观看 | 男女久久久国产一区二区三区 | 国产69久久精品成人看 | 久久久久国产精品无码免费看 | 亚洲精品成人网久久久久久 | 亚洲精品无码久久久 | 亚洲一区二区无码影院 | 国产欧美二区综合 | 精品无码人妻av受辱日韩 | 免费无码又爽又刺激高潮的视频 | 丰满少妇呻吟高潮经历 | 国产成人综合色在线观看网站 | 中国女人内谢69xxxx | 亚洲欧美日韩国产另类电影 | 亚洲国产成人高清在线播放 |